Le php est mort, vive le php...
14-01-2010 11:31
к комментариям - к полной версии
- понравилось!
Я достаю кубик d20 и грею его в руках, говоря: "больше 10 - Java, меньше - продолжаю возиться с этим...". Ха! Крит! 20. И php повержен с удара.
(да, так я послденее время гадаю :) а почему бы, собственно, и нет)
Кажется, мое знакомство с symfony закончено. Надеюсь, с php тоже (хотя, брат, наш с Тобой проект это не коснется).
За несколько неудачных попыток, подробности которых описывать не буду, резюмиря только, что все сделано достаточно криво, и нелогично, я окончательно подустала от этого фреймворка.
Мы явно не сходимся с ним во мнениях, я, например, считаю, что разработчик умнее фреймворка, а он - наоборот. Чего только стоит самостоятельное изменение модели на основе данных в бд. Казалось бы, чего проще - выкинуть исключение, мол, давай разберемся, в БД совсем другая модель, и связи другие. Но нет, symfony, а точнее ее ORM - Doctrine смело штурмует схему моей модели, и в результате я получаю дублирующие связи.
Понятно, что я не права, и что-то делаю не так, да, я не очистила БД перед обновлением, но подобные ошибки не должны стоить разработчику дополнительного времени на восстановление изковерканных кусков модели. По крайней мере работа такого же ORM в яве приучила меня думать именно так...
Ура.
вверх^
к полной версии
понравилось!
в evernote